Core Skills Analysis
Mathematics
- The student practiced basic arithmetic through managing in-game resources, learning to calculate quantities of materials needed for building.
- They developed problem-solving skills by strategizing the best way to utilize their resources effectively.
- Estimation skills improved as the student had to estimate distances and the amount of time needed to complete tasks within the game.
- Exposure to geometric concepts occurred when constructing structures, allowing them to understand shapes and spatial awareness.
Science
- The student learned about ecosystems by interacting with various biomes within the game, observing different plant and animal life.
- They gained an understanding of basic physics by experimenting with gravity and motion through character movements and object interactions.
- The importance of resource management was highlighted as the student learned about sustainable practices by responsibly gathering materials.
- Engagement with technology was encouraged as students used logical thinking to navigate challenges in the game.
Art & Design
- The student expressed creativity by designing their own unique structures within the game, honing their artistic skills.
- Aesthetic considerations were learned by understanding color theory and spatial organization when planning builds.
- The game encouraged experimentation with different materials, enhancing the student's appreciation for various textures and forms.
- Collaboration with peers in creating projects within the game fostered teamwork and communication regarding artistic ideas.
Literacy
- The student improved vocabulary skills by reading in-game texts, understanding instructions, and dialogues with characters.
- Critical thinking was enhanced as they interpreted game narratives, predicting outcomes and making inferences about the storyline.
- Writing skills were practiced when documenting strategies or creating in-game manuals for other players.
- The student developed comprehension skills by engaging with quest descriptions, which required attention to detail.
Tips
To further enhance the child's learning experience, consider integrating additional educational games that complement their interests in subjects like mathematics and science. Encourage them to maintain a journal documenting their gameplay experiences, thoughts on design choices, and strategies they developed. Suggest collaborative projects with peers to promote teamwork and communication. Also, setting specific goals for resource management could deepen their understanding of sustainability practices in both in-game and real-life contexts.
